Player Story
Trace Christian built his college career from 2018 through 2020 as a running back from Longwood, FL wearing No. 32, spending time with East Carolina. The clearest part of Trace Christian's career was his backfield work: 428 rushing yards, 101 carries, 1 rushing touchdown, and 43 receiving yards across 15 career games in the available record. His career also includes 43 receiving yards and 2 tackles, giving the story more than a single-category snapshot.
